A savvy traveller has revealed just how she managed to move to the beautiful Thai island rent free for two months – and it involves lots of dog cuddles on the beach
While the latest season of The White Lotus has continued to divide fans, there’s one thing everyone can agree on – the stunning Thai island setting is the real star of the show.
The idyllic island of Koh Samui – Thailand’s second largest after Phuket – is where the HBO hit was filmed, and thanks to one savvy traveller, we now know how to stay there without spending a single penny on accommodation. TikTok user Iona (@ionatravels) has gone viral after sharing how she ditched the UK for a tropical lifestyle on the island, swapping her 9 to 5 for sunshine, sandy beaches, and surprisingly a whole lot of dog cuddles.

In her videos, Iona reveals that she used the volunteer exchange platform Worldpackers to set herself up in Koh Samui, where she stayed for two months while volunteering at a local dog sanctuary.
“You can exchange your skills for free accommodation and even sometimes free activities too,” she told followers, adding that the experience allowed her to travel “as cheaply as possible for as long as possible”.
And it turns out the perks go far beyond just a free place to stay. Iona listed a host of bonuses: from language lessons and free parties to yoga sessions, tours, transport, and – of course – long beach days.
“[You get] free accommodation in such a beautiful non-touristy part of Koh Samui in exchange for giving the sweetest dogs in the world a happier life,” she said.
The only requirements? You need to be over 18 and happy to volunteer around 25 hours a week, with one day off guaranteed. In return, you get to live like a local, give back to the community, and soak up the serenity of island life.
Worldpackers currently offers placements in over 140 countries, with options ranging from turtle conservation in Costa Rica to teaching English in Indonesia.
Iona showed how easy it was to get started: create a profile, choose a destination, message a host, and you’re “good to go.”
